About usThe Royal Australian and New Zealand College of Psychiatrists (RANZCP) is the leading membership organisation for training, accrediting, and representing psychiatrists across Australia and Aotearoa New Zealand. Through conferences, publications, and initiatives, the College drives evidence-based practices, ensures high-quality, culturally aligned care, and works to enhance healthcare outcomes for Aboriginal, Torres Strait Islander, and Māori communities in alignment with reconciliation and Te Tiriti o Waitangi.About the RoleThis is a fixed-term, part-time position (0.8 FTE) commencing immediately, covering parental leave until August 2026.In this role, you will coordinate, develop, and deliver a range of RANZCP conferences each year, providing end-to-end in-house conference management for designated events. Depending on the event, you may also collaborate with Professional Conference Organisers (PCOs). The role requires national travel and onsite presence at conferences.Key responsibilities include:Delivering end-to-end management of allocated conferences, in collaboration with relevant local organising and scientific program committees. This includes budgeting, venue selection, program development, marketing, registration, speaker coordination, conference materials (including apps), accommodation, social functions, sponsorship, exhibitions, and post-event evaluation.Designing conference programs in partnership with committees to support members’ continuing professional development.Managing and maintaining online systems for registrations, abstract submissions and reviews, certification, and event reporting.For a full list of responsibilities please refer to the position description.What You'll Bring
